Mean Man, it's "Trilogy" you have it right.
I'm seriously starting to wonder if this guy is even going to listen to anything we say as he's posted a ton of times without seemingly paying attention to the answers he's getting. As far as trilogies go, they're a decent marker, but not high-end by any means. They were WGP's second attempt (after their ill-fated "ranger" that held no resemblance to the original WGP Ranger pump) to enter the low-end market and make a product that they could market to people with budgetary constraints. They're a solid marker, they're fairly upgradeable, and with an SF frame and MQ valve, they can even compete on a higher end. But like most other entry-level markers, they take as much money to upgrade to a competition level as it would take to just go out and buy a high-end electro. WGP realized that they'd do better selling a stacked-tube blowback that was simple to maintain and much more tuned out of the box and decided to ax the majority of the 'cocker line. As for the new WGP markers, believe it or not, the first reviews out there seem rather good. The synergy is getting great reviews (much to DeTrevni's chagrin ) and is fairing far better under playing conditions than a comparable spyder-clone. I've yet to hear much about the MG-7 though it looks like a spooler. As far as the SR goes, I'd love to get one in my hands. The tech behind it is rather sound even if the grip frame looks like the ugly love child of an early '00's Angel and and a 'timmy.

Seriously... spyders are NOT high ends. They are low ends, very low ends. Almost as low as it gets. (almost)
Where are you getting that impression from? If you plan to use a high rate of fire, you will need hpa. On to your question: $600 can go a long way or a little way depending on of you will buy used or not. Here is a good breakdown of what you need to run high end: Hpa tank... $50-$180 used or $100-250 used Hopper... $30-70 used or $80-150 new Depending if you have a high quality one or not (don't cheap out on masks whatever you do), you may need a mask... $30-60 used $60-100 new I did that to give you an idea of how much it is just to set up a high end marker. Those are just the essensials. So tell us the amount that you would like to spend, what you require in a marker, and what equipment you already have. |
